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Damage: The severity of the fire damage significantly impacts the overall cost of reconstruction.
- Type of Materials Used: High-quality or specialized materials can increase costs.
- Labor Costs: Local labor rates in Truckee can vary and affect the total expense.
- Permit Fees: Obtaining the necessary permits for reconstruction in Truckee can add to the cost.
- Site Accessibility: Difficult-to-access sites may require additional equipment or labor, increasing costs.
- Time of Year: Seasonal weather conditions in Truckee can influence reconstruction timelines and costs.
- Insurance Coverage: The extent of your insurance coverage can impact out-of-pocket expenses.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ost in Truckee, CA |
---|---|
Initial Assessment | $500 - $1,000 |
Debris Removal | $1,000 - $5,000 |
Structural Repairs | $10,000 - $50,000 |
Electrical System Repairs | $2,000 - $10,000 |
Plumbing System Repairs | $1,500 - $7,500 |
HVAC System Repairs | $3,000 - $12,000 |
Interior Finishing (drywall, paint) | $5,000 - $20,000 |
Flooring Replacement | $3,000 - $15,000 |
Roofing Repairs | $5,000 - $25,000 |
Mold Remediation | $1,000 - $6,000 |
